What is an Entrepreneur?
An entrepreneur is someone who starts a business to make their dreams come true. Whether they plan to open the best cafe or develop a fitness app, they invest time and capital in their business idea and work hard to make it a success. Entrepreneurs often partner with other investors, hire workers, and take risks in pursuit of success.Entrepreneurs tend to have natural problem-solving skills and an unstoppable attitude. Also, many people are confident and believe their ideas are great. They refuse to back down and, at worst, take the word “no” as a temporary setback. There are many home success stories. Many of them experienced a lot of setbacks and pressure from family, friends and potential investors, but they persevered.The richest entrepreneurs are popular symbols of success. It may sound easy, but the reality is that most entrepreneurs spend countless hours and tons of capital behind the scenes to be successful.

Benefits of Being an Entrepreneur
Now that you understand how entrepreneurship works, here are some benefits of entrepreneurship.
1.Ability to Work from Anywhere
One of the main benefits of being an entrepreneur is that you usually have the option of working from home or another location. With so many types of businesses that can be run online, in many cases all you need to become an entrepreneur is a laptop and internet access. Working from home is an economical way to start a business. So whether you prefer your living room, cafe, or beach (as some digital nomads do), you can open a shop anywhere without paying rent at work.
2. Flexible schedule
In addition to working from anywhere, you can choose when to work as an entrepreneur. So decide when you can devote your day to family, sports, or other activities.Note that the “office” is never closed. That is why some entrepreneurs are known to work 16 hours a day (or more) in order to reach their goals. Because of this, setting your own schedule can be a double-edged sword that can lead to overwork and burnout.Remember that work-life balance is important.
